Wednesday's Sport Update

Shamrock Rovers lost 3-2 on aggregate, athletics update and racing.

SOCCER

Shamrock Rovers missed out on a place in the third round of qualifying for the Champions League last night.

Stephen Bradley's side beat Ararat-Armenia 2-1 in the second leg of their tie in Tallaght Stadium - but lost 3-2 on aggregate

They'll now drop down to the Europa League, and face KF Egnatia of Albania in the third qualifying round.

Elsewhere, Hearts crashed out of the Champions League with a 6-0 aggregate defeat to Sturm Graz.

Liverpool are reportedly the frontrunners to sign Bradley Barcola from Paris Saint-Germain.

Reports from France suggest that the forward has reached a verbal agreement to move to Anfield, but the two clubs are yet to settle on a fee.

Arsenal are also keen to sign the 23-year-old France star, after Real Madrid said Vinicius Junior will not be leaving.

The UK Prime Minister and UEFA are among those who have come out against Fifa's plans to sell off its competitions.

The world governing body wants to seek private investment for events like the World Cup.

Andy Burnham says "football is for the fans. Not for investors".

While the European nation's association is refusing to rule out boycotting Fifa events.


ATHLETICS

Sharlene Mawdsley says she is doing "everything possible" to recover quickly from a hamstring injury ahead of the European Athletics Championships.

The Tipperary sprinter pulled up during the 200-metres final at the National Track and Field Championships in Santry on Saturday.

She was included in the 20-person Ireland squad heading to Birmingham next month.

===

Kate O'Connor has the overnight lead in the heptathlon at the 2026 Commonwealth Games

She will compete in the long jump and the javelin, before rounding out her campaign with the 800-metres tonight.

O'Connor is chasing a first-ever senior outdoor gold medal.
